Here’s the latest CLOUDY WITH A CHANCE OF MEATBALLS 2 TV Spot which announces it’s ‘an adventure 65 billion calories in the making’. That’s not the only thing that hints at a JURASSIC PARK style sequel, as we see giant food monsters running amok on the island of Swallow Falls. Flint Lockwood (Bill Hader) and team, must travel back to their hometown where life has found a way, and food has evolved.
I’m a sucker for a good pun, and this film seems to have nothing but food related wordplay. The first was an enjoyable and irreverent film, full of bonkers nonsense and it looks as though somebody has cranked it up to 11 this time around.
CLOUDY WITH A CHANCE OF MEATBALLS 2 is released on 27th September 2013 in the US and 25th October 2013 in the UK. It stars the vocal talents of Bill Hader, Anna Faris, Andy Samberg, Neil Patrick Harris, James Caan, and Terry Crews.
